A Fuzzy Information Retrieval Method Based on the Vector-Correlative Model
Abstract
The VCM (Vector-Correlative Model) is one of the currently popular models for information searching. In this paper, author inducted Fuzzy Sets theory and approach for to construct information searching models, and presented a new VCM, which is called Fuzzy Vector-correlative Model (FVCM). So, its theory structure and user's searching quizzing mode has been dimming improved. We have show with some fringe experimentation that the new model has overcome some intrinsic defects of the exciting ones, and has raised the precision and recall of information search system.
